Word-by-Word Analysis
| # | Original | Strong's | English | Definition |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| וַֽיִּפְסְל֞וּ | H6458 | did hew | to carve, whether wood or stone |
| 2 | לִבְנ֥וֹת | H1129 | builders | to build (literally and figuratively) |
| 3 | שְׁלֹמֹ֛ה | H8010 | And Solomon's | shelomah, david's successor |
| 4 | לִבְנ֥וֹת | H1129 | builders | to build (literally and figuratively) |
| 5 | חִיר֖וֹם | H2438 | and Hiram's | chiram or chirom, the name of two tyrians |
| 6 | וְהַגִּבְלִ֑ים | H1382 | them and the stonesquarers | a gebalite, or inhabitant of gebal |
| 7 | וַיָּכִ֛ינוּ | H3559 | so they prepared | properly, to be erect (i.e., stand perpendicular); hence (causatively) to set up, in a great variety of applications, whether literal (establish, fix, |
| 8 | הָֽעֵצִ֥ים | H6086 | timber | a tree (from its firmness); hence, wood (plural sticks) |
| 9 | וְהָֽאֲבָנִ֖ים | H68 | and stones | a stone |
| 10 | לִבְנ֥וֹת | H1129 | builders | to build (literally and figuratively) |
| 11 | הַבָּֽיִת׃ | H1004 | the house | a house (in the greatest variation of applications, especially family, etc.) |
